I don't get the negativity toward this camera. Start with the basic size and IQ of a P&S and add all the stuff we love about our DSLRs, like RAW image files, interchangeable lenses and the ability to add filters (a biggie for me). I like that! I'm willing to swap IQ for size when I need portability. I have a Canon SD800 that I use when I need to travel light. Its pics are fine for posting on the 'net or sharing with friends, but I chaff at the inability to add a ND filter or take an HDR series or have the RAW image to work with or take a 1:1 macro or go to 300mm. I think the best compact right now is the Canon G12. I've come so close to getting it, but just can't see paying $500 and still living with the P&S limitations. I'm ready to pay $300 more to get P&S IQ with DSLR flexibility.
